Understanding the Calls from 03 8652 7379
The phone number 03 8652 7379 / 0386527379 has recently come to the attention of many users for all the wrong reasons. Classified as a spam call, this number has been reported to make alarming claims. Specifically, callers have been purporting to be representatives of well-known financial institutions such as Visa, Mastercard, and even PayPal, implying that there have been questionable transactions on accounts they often do not manage.
What Users Are Saying
User reports indicate that the conversations often start with alarming messages regarding suspicious transactions, particularly invoking the Commonwealth Bank when many of the recipients of these calls have no association with the bank. Such tactics appear to pressure recipients into providing their private information, embodying a classic method of identity theft.
Fraud Types Associated with This Number
- PayPal Scam: Calls often reference PayPal to instil a sense of urgency, leading individuals to potentially divulge sensitive information.
- Banking Fraud: Impersonating well-known banks, these scammers aim to mislead unsuspecting individuals into believing there is a legitimate issue with their bank account.
How to Deal with 03 8652 7379 / 0386527379 Calls
If you receive a call from this number, it is crucial to take the following steps:
- Do not engage with the caller or provide any personal information.
- Hang up and verify any claims by contacting your bank or PayPal directly, using trusted methods.
- Report the number to relevant authorities or use identity theft protection services to safeguard your information.
